With the popularization and development of the Internet, the issue of network security and information security has received increasing attention. Cybersecurity vulnerabilities, encryption technology and security awareness are three important aspects in the field of cybersecurity, which we will learn more about below.
First, let's talk about network security vulnerabilities. Network security vulnerabilities are weaknesses or flaws in a network system that can be exploited by attackers for illegal activities. These vulnerabilities may be caused by software design flaws, configuration errors or human error. For network security, we need to fix these vulnerabilities. Common network security vulnerabilities include buffer overflow, cross-site scripting attacks (XSS) and SQL injection. To prevent these vulnerabilities from being exploited, we can take measures such as updating software patches regularly, using firewalls and intrusion detection systems.
Secondly, encryption technology is one of the most important means to protect network security. Encryption technology makes it impossible for unauthorized people to read and tamper with data by converting it into ciphertext. Common encryption algorithms include symmetric encryption algorithms and asymmetric encryption algorithms. Symmetric encryption algorithms use the same key for encryption and decryption, while asymmetric encryption algorithms use a pair of public and private keys for encryption and decryption. In addition, digital signatures and digital certificates are important components of encryption technology for verifying the authenticity and integrity of data.
Finally, security awareness is one of the key factors in protecting network security. Security awareness refers to the degree of people's knowledge and attention to network security. In our daily life, we should develop good network security habits, personal information, do not click on suspicious chains do not download software from unknown sources and so on. In addition, we should backup important data regularly to prevent data loss or tampering.
In conclusion, network security and information security are challenges we must face in the digital era. By learning about network security vulnerabilities, encryption technology and security awareness, we can better protect our network security. At the same time, the government and enterprises should also strengthen cybersecurity education and training to enhance the public's cybersecurity awareness and capability. Only in this way can we work together to build a more secure and reliable network environment.